100-year-old Albert Bauman was retired farmer and school bus driver
Albert F. Bauman, 100, died Sept. 7, 2016, at 10:56 a.m. at Mennonite Memorial Home, Bluffton.
Albert was born Sept. 17, 1915 in Union Township, Hancock County, Ohio, to the late Reuben and Lina (Klammer) Bauman. On Nov. 10, 1940 he married Geneva King Bauman who preceded him in death on Sept. 18, 2003.
Albert was a farmer and drove school bus for Mt. Cory for many years. He was a member of Mt. Cory United Methodist Church, Hancock County Farm Bureau and was a graduate of Mt. Cory High School.
Survivors include two sons, Dwayne (Pat) Bauman of Mt. Cory, Ohio, Lynn (Jane) Bauman of Edmund, Oklahoma; four grandchildren, Diane (Toby) Bertke, Melissa (John) Curtis, Aaron (Marta) Bauman; a great grandson, Braeden Bauman; and two step great grandchildren, Ashley and Caitlin Fitzpatrick.
Services will be held Tuesday, Sept. 13, at 10:30 a.m. at Chiles-Laman Funeral & Cremation Services, Bluffton. Pastor Mark Fuerstenau officiating. Burial will be in Clymer Cemetery near Mt. Cory following the service.
Visitation will be Monday from 6 - 8 p.m. at the funeral home.
Memorial contributions may be made to Mt. Cory United Methodist Church of Mennonite Memorial Home.
